Default Caution- Likely exhibit reprints ebay

Hi All, I just wanted to give a heads up these auctions as likely reprints (can not confirm without back pictures) but they are the exact player/team combo of the white back reprints and all in mint condition. Red flags. These are tough to tell as the front detail quality is very close to the originals. Seller has a refund policy, as a worst case.

Thanks Scott. I remember buying a lot of Exhibits from a nearby penny arcade as a kid, and their size would certainly have made it difficult to keep them in any condition similar to those posted. I would agree they are to be given careful scrutiny, since I haven't heard of any recent warehouse find or the like. It would be interesting to view the halftone dot pattern under 16X.
